Platinum 300 C4

Wide-Pore HPLC Column for Peptide and Protein Analysis

Platinum 300 C4 is a silica-based HPLC column with a butyl bonded phase on wide-pore (300 Å) silica, specifically engineered for the separation of peptides, proteins, and other biomacromolecules. The short C4 chains provide reduced hydrophobic retention compared to C18 or C8, allowing gentler interactions and faster elution of large biomolecules.

The wide-pore structure ensures excellent accessibility for high-molecular-weight analytes, delivering sharp peak shapes, reproducibility, and robustness. Platinum 300 C4 is particularly suitable for biopharmaceutical and proteomic applications requiring reliable separations of sensitive biomolecules.

Key Features:

  • Wide-pore silica stationary phase with butyl (C4) bonded chemistry

  • Reduced hydrophobic retention for large biomolecules

  • Optimized for peptides, proteins, and macromolecular analysis

  • High reproducibility and robust column lifetime

  • Available particle sizes: 3 µm, 5 µm, 10 µm

Typical Applications:

  • Separation of peptides and small to medium-sized proteins

  • Biopharmaceutical testing of therapeutic proteins and biomolecules

  • Proteomic research requiring gentle retention of large analytes

  • Method development for biomolecular separations with reduced hydrophobicity
